Comprehending ADHD: A Brief Overview
ADHD manifests in different forms, primarily categorized into 3 types:
| Type | Attributes |
|---|---|
| Mainly Inattentive Presentation | Trouble in sustaining attention, following detailed instructions, and organizing jobs. |
| Primarily Hyperactive-Impulsive Presentation | Excessive fidgeting, uneasyness, impulsiveness, and problem waiting on one's turn. |
| Combined Presentation | Signs of both impulsivity/hyperactivity and inattention are widespread. |
Each individual's experience with ADHD is distinct, making precise diagnosis necessary for effective treatment and support.

The Process of Seeking a Private Diagnosis
The journey towards a private ADHD diagnosis usually involves several essential steps:
Step 1: Initial Consultation
The very first visit typically consists of a detailed interview that covers case history, family history, and the particular symptoms the individual is experiencing.
Step 2: Standardized Assessment Tools
Clinicians often use various assessment tools to evaluate signs methodically. These may include:
| Assessment Tool | Description |
|---|---|
| Conners Adult ADHD Rating Scale | A widely used questionnaire that examines numerous elements of ADHD symptoms. |
| adult adhd private assessment (speaking of) 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S) | A self-assessment tool to examine ADHD symptoms based on individual experiences. |
| Constant Performance Test (CPT) | A digital test developed to determine attention control and impulsivity. |
Step 3: Feedback Session
After examinations are total, a follow-up session is carried out in which the clinician talks about the findings. If ADHD is diagnosed, the clinician will explore treatment alternatives such as therapy, medication, or techniques for managing signs.

Step 4: Developing a Management Plan
A robust management plan customized to a person's requirements, including therapy sessions, coping strategies, and academic resources, will be developed to assist handle the disorder successfully.

Common FAQs About Private ADHD Diagnosis
1. How much does a private ADHD diagnosis expense?
The expenses can differ extensively depending on the clinician, geographic area, and the intricacy of the assessment. It normally ranges from ₤ 200 to ₤ 2,500.
2. Is a private diagnosis legally recognized?
Yes, a diagnosis from a certified health care professional is lawfully recognized, whether from a public or private source.
3. Can I seek a private diagnosis without a recommendation?
The majority of private practices do not need a referral. People can typically self-refer for an assessment.

4. What should I give my very first appointment?
It's practical to bring a list of signs, any previous medical records appropriate to your mental health history, and info on family case history.
5. Can kids be detected through private services?
Yes, many private practices specialize in pediatric assessments and can provide a comprehensive assessment for children as well.
